CD & L Tampa - Hours & Locations
CD & L - Tampa
1604 North 60th Street, Tampa FL 33602 Phone Number:(813) 664-1770Hours may fluctuate
Distance:0.57 miles
CD & L - Fort Myers
6490 Metro Plantation Road, Fort Myers FL 33602 Phone Number:(239) 939-4050Hours may fluctuate
Distance:0.57 miles